Founded in 1957, Pacific Western Transportation (PWT) is the largest privately-owned passenger transportation company in Canada. Today PWT offers comprehensive transportation services and solutions across the country, with over 4,000 employees and numerous business locations. Our operations are separated into four divisions: Motor Coach, Oilsands, Student Transportation, and Transit.

PWT’s varied operations are unified by a company-wide commitment to the Core Values first established by our founder R.B. (Bob) Colborne. At the heart of these core values is an unwavering dedication to customer service and safety, as supported by our Safely Home brand.
